Subject[PATCH 0/3] Series short description
Date
The following series address issues with the ioatdma driver. The first
patch fixes a potential ring size overflow. The next two patches put
in alignment requirement for silicon errata on the ioatdma hardware related to
M2M ops and impacts NETDMA. The last patch will probably need to be
ack'd by David Miller as it touches the network subsystem.
---

Dave Jiang (3):
netdma: adding alignment check for NETDMA ops
ioatdma: DMA copy alignment needed to address IOAT DMA silicon errata
ioat: ring size variables need to be 32bit to avoid overflow
